Course content
The subject content is to get acquainted with the basics of user interface (GUI) and web page design, to understand the principles of working with information, to acquire the ability to analyze and the resulting well-designed structure, organization of the content of the message, visualization of information in terms of its hierarchy, aggregation, function, dynamics, distribution, etc. with respect to the needs of the user, the environment and the technology used, shape and color symbolism, movement / animation as an additional carrier of the message. The learning objectives are achieved through a combination of real-world tasks (where the emphasis is on the feasibility of the solution), academic tasks (where the feasibility of the solution may not be an absolute requirement) and experimental or visionary tasks (the emphasis is on the idea and its presentation, not its feasibility). The teacher guides students to think independently and critically, points out errors and offers principles leading to possible solutions.
